CBN Governor, Finance Ministry, Hakeem Olanrewaju to Attend MARAN Forum on Nigeria-China Currency Swap

The Maritime Reporters Association of Nigeria (MARAN) has announced the confirmed participation of top government officials and industry stakeholders at its upcoming breakfast meeting focused on the Nigeria–Peoples Republic of China currency swap agreement.

The Governor of the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N), Mr. Olayemi Cardoso, officials from the Federal Ministry of Finance, and the Chairman of the Customs Consultative Council, Aare Hakeem Olanrewaju, are among the high-profile personalities scheduled to attend the event.

The forum, titled “Navigating the Nigeria-Peoples Republic of China Currency Swap: Opportunities and Challenges for Import, Export and Maritime Business”, is set to take place on Tuesday, April 15, 2025, at the Rockview Hotel, Apapa, Lagos.

MARAN President, Mr. Godfrey Bivbere, disclosed that the CBN Governor has pledged full representation at the forum, while the Ministry of Finance has also indicated interest in active participation. Aare Hakeem Olanrewaju, who will serve as Chairman of the meeting, has equally confirmed his attendance.

Also expected at the forum are representatives from the Chinese Embassy, the Association of Nigerian Licensed Customs Agents (ANLCA), the Nigeria-China Strategic Partnership (NCSP), as well as a wide range of importers, exporters, maritime operators, financial institutions, economists, and trade analysts.

Bivbere stated that the event is in line with MARAN’s objective of promoting dialogue on key policies affecting the maritime sector and broader trade environment. He explained that the currency swap between Nigeria and China is designed to ease trade transactions between the two countries by enabling the use of the Naira and the Yuan, thereby reducing reliance on the U.S. dollar.

He noted that with growing concerns over foreign exchange volatility, the forum will provide an essential platform for stakeholders to evaluate the potential of the currency swap agreement to stabilize trade, reduce transaction costs, and improve foreign exchange management.

“It has become imperative for Nigeria to adopt innovative strategies to safeguard its economic stability and reduce dependence on the U.S. dollar for international trade,” Bivbere said. “This currency swap agreement with China is a crucial step in that direction, and the MARAN forum will provide the needed insights to help stakeholders fully understand its implications and opportunities.”

The meeting will feature robust discussions on policy implementation, trade facilitation, and the impact of exchange rate fluctuations on the maritime and logistics industries.
